is creed green irish tweed pretty much a safe bet? basenotes seems to think real highly of it. anyone have experience with it?
It's on my list to try, but you really can't go wrong with Creed IMO, unless you already know that you won't like the notes. From top to bottom, Green Irish Tweed is citrus -> floral -> earthy, which should make it a very fresh-smelling scent. Great for summer, probably.
I may have mentioned it before in this thread, but if you like rum, coconut, pineapple, and other sweet notes, try a sample of Creed's Virgin Island Water. It was released last year and it's a great summer fragrance. It smells like the best suntan lotion on earth.
